Key Concepts: What Makes a Good Yoga Mat for Beginners?

  • Thickness: A mat that is too thin may cause discomfort in certain poses, while a mat that is too thick can hinder balance. The ideal thickness for a beginner’s mat is typically around 6mm.
  • Material: The material of your yoga mat impacts durability, grip, and eco-friendliness. Most beginner-friendly mats are made from PVC, TPE, or natural rubber.
  • Grip: A good yoga mat provides a strong grip to prevent slipping during poses. Stickier mats are often preferred by beginners to maintain balance.
  • Durability: High-quality mats should withstand frequent use without wearing down or losing their grip.
  • Portability: A lightweight mat is easier to carry, especially if you’re planning to take classes at a studio.

Historical Context of Yoga Mats

Yoga has been practiced for thousands of years, but the concept of the modern yoga mat is a relatively recent development. Historically, practitioners used animal skins or grass as their surface for yoga. It wasn’t until the 1980s that Angela Farmer, a yoga teacher, popularized the use of sticky mats in the West after modifying carpet underlay to improve her grip.

Implementation Guidelines for Buying Your First Yoga Mat

When buying your first yoga mat, consider the following factors to ensure you make the right decision:

  1. Set a budget: Yoga mats can range from $20 to over $100. Determine what you’re willing to spend based on how often you plan to practice.
  2. Think about the material: PVC is affordable and durable, but less eco-friendly. TPE offers a good balance between grip and eco-friendliness, while natural rubber is biodegradable but heavier.
  3. Test the grip: If possible, try out a mat before buying. Ensure it has the right amount of stickiness to keep you stable in poses.
  4. Consider portability: If you plan on attending classes, a lighter mat that’s easy to roll up and carry will be essential.
